In short β€” in early 2025, the 3 JPI methods (based on the most reliable analysts, β‰₯2 who beat their sector) would each have selected 20 S&P 500 stocks, held 12 months. Real results: 🟒 Light β€” Β· 🎯 Fair +56% Β· ⚑ Risk+ +54% β€” vs +16% for the S&P 500. Best selection (Fair): WDC (Western Digital) at +282%.

These stocks were not cherry-picked in hindsight: they are the ones the method would have selected using only info known by end of 2024 (price targets from reliable analysts in the prior ~90 days), then held unchanged for 12 months. A true point-in-time record.

How were these 2025 stocks chosen?

With no hindsight: only from information known by end of 2024 (price targets from analysts with a real reliability track record on their sector), then held 12 months. A point-in-time backtest, not a hindsight pick.

Does this method actually work?

Over 11 years (2015-2025), the JPI Fair method returned +26%/yr vs +12.6% for the S&P 500 β€” double the market. But it's lumpy (drawdowns in 2018 and 2022) and risk-adjusted the edge is thinner. A quality signal, not a guarantee.

What is JPI Invest?

JPI Invest aggregates analyst recommendations across the entire S&P 500 (plus the S&P MidCap 400), replays them against real prices and measures who predicts best β€” on results, not reputation. Instead of taking a price target at face value, you see each analyst's track record on each stock.
